Signified
For Saussure, the signified was one of the two parts of the sign (which was indivisible except for analytical purposes). Saussure's signified is the mental concept represented by the signifier (and is not a material thing). This does not exclude the reference of signs to physical objects in the world as well as to abstract concepts and fictional entities, but the signified is not itself a referent in the world (in contrast to Peirce's object). It is common for subsequent interpreters to equate the signified with 'content' (matching the form of the signifier in the familiar dualism of 'form and content').
